The purpose of this study was to investigate the characteristics of female-headed households in Pakistan. "[A] sample of 680 working women will be used to analyse the economic situation of households headed by women relative to households headed by men. The paper will compare income levels, household size and composition and employment patterns in the two sets of households. Further, the study will also investigate differences in income and employment options within the subset of households headed by women." The poverty of households headed by women was generally found to reflect the disadvantaged position of women in the labor market. Comments by Nahced Aziz are included (pp. 788-90)
